Uranus in Capricorn meaning
Because Uranus is slow, its sign describes a generation's shared instinct more than one life story. In Capricorn, cardinal earth, the reforming energy meets tradition, structure, and authority head on. It wants to overhaul the systems that run things: institutions, hierarchies, the rules that decide who holds power.
The temperament is disciplined yet quietly rebellious. People with this placement often respect competence while distrusting authority that has stopped earning its place, and they tend to change things from the inside, patiently, rather than by walking away.
The strength is durable reform, the kind that replaces a broken structure with a better one instead of just tearing it down. The tension is real, since the planet of revolution sits in the sign of the establishment. Handled well, it modernises what matters without losing the stability worth keeping.
